mysql ddl操作(mysql查询条件执行顺序)

由于mysql在线ddl(加字段、加索引等修改表结构之类的操作)过程如下: A.对表加锁(表此时只读)B.复制原表物理结构C.修改表的物理结构D.把原表数据导入中间表中,数据同步完后,锁定中间表,并删除原表E.rename中间表为原表F.刷新数据字典,并释放锁普遍,对于大表的处理,目前没有特别好的解决方案。大部分公司都会有个瞬断的过程。

大家好,又见面了,我是你们的朋友全栈君。

由于mysql在线ddl(加字段、加索引等修改表结构之类的操作)过程如下:

 A.对表加锁(表此时只读)
B.复制原表物理结构,创建新中间表
C.修改中间表的物理结构
D.把原表数据导入中间表中,数据同步完后,锁定中间表,并删除原表
E.rename中间表为原表
F.刷新数据字典,并释放锁

普遍,对于大表的处理 ,目前没有特别好的解决方案 。 大部分公司都会有个瞬断的过程 。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/128015.html原文链接:https://javaforall.net

(0)
上一篇 2022年4月11日 上午11:20
下一篇 2022年4月11日 上午11:20


相关推荐

  • JavaScript语法学习(一文带你学会JavaScript)

    JavaScript语法学习(一文带你学会JavaScript)概述所有的代码必须写在<scripttype=“text/javascript”>当中。如果需要引用外部的js文件,格式为 <scripttype=“text/javascript”src=“XXXXX”></script>src为链接的外部地址 而此时所有的代码必须为外部文件,写在其中的代码无效。每一句js语句后面都要跟上分号为了语法规范,script标签应该写在head标签当中,且可以引入多个script标签表示不同功能块&lt;可以表示

    2025年11月10日
    6
  • C++求最大公约数和最小公倍数

    C++求最大公约数和最小公倍数方法一:辗转相除法   用"较大数"除以"较小数",再用"较小数"除以"第一余数",再用“第一余数”除以 “第二余数",   如此反复,直到最后余数是0为止。如果是求两个数的最大公约数,那么最后的除数就是这两个数的最大公约数。#include&lt;stdio.h&gt;#include&lt;stdlib.h&gt;#include&a

    2022年5月13日
    38
  • AbstractInterceptor和Interceptor的区别

    AbstractInterceptor和Interceptor的区别AbstractInterceptor实现了Interceptor接口,并且空实现了init()和destroy()方法。在使用中,如果无需实现init和destroy方法,可以直接实现AbstractInterceptor

    2022年5月15日
    42
  • “龙虾”卸载指南,来了!被“龙虾”创始人质疑抄袭?

    “龙虾”卸载指南,来了!被“龙虾”创始人质疑抄袭?

    2026年3月13日
    2
  • mediumtext_【紧急求助】关于mediumtext类型数据的调用

    mediumtext_【紧急求助】关于mediumtext类型数据的调用你的位置:问答吧->PHP基础->问题详情【紧急求助】关于mediumtext类型数据的调用请问各位大大,我如何将mediumtext类型的数据调用输入textarea文本框中呢?主要的问题是mediumtext内没有回车完全可以正常调用,但一旦有回车就无法进行调用,文本框中输入不了任何数据!恳请各位大大不…

    2022年6月12日
    30
  • IDEA乱码解决合集

    IDEA乱码解决合集问题来源最近做一些 JavaWeb 项目的时候在 IDEA 和 Tomcat 的字符上被坑了 目前我看到的许多解决乱码问题都是很全面 因此想做一个自己总结的解决乱码的合集 一 IDEA 内部文件编码设置 1 打开 IDEA 点击左上角的 File 选择 Settings2 选择 Editor 再选择右边的 FileEncoding 将下面三个地方改成 UTF 8 并 Apply4 再次打开 File 选择 NewProjectSe 的 SettingsForN 和第三步相同的设

    2026年3月17日
    2

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号